Winston is tough. He gets yards because that team has talent but he doesn't make decisions that win football games. Its the whole 'the QB makes its money in the red zone' argument and if he doesn't get it done by like week 5 or 6 then he should be pretty much done in the league. I might be overrating him.

As far as Luck is concerned, I'm not sure where to rank him. He only got sacked 2.7% of his dropbacks last year which is pretty crazy low. Its possible that its sustainable with the talent they have there but I'm not sure we're going to see that every year. He looked very pedestrian in the playoffs against KC and a lot of people were picking Indy in that game because KC's defense was suspect. #9-12 is the ballpark where I think he is right now.
